Section 15: The Vice-Chancellor

Azim Premji University Ordinance, 2009State Ordinance of Karnataka · No. 14 of 2010

(1) The Vice-Chancellor shall be appointed by the Chancellor, on such terms and conditions as may be laid down by the Statutes from among three persons recommended by the Nomination Committee constituted in accordance with the provisions of subsection (2).

(2) The Nomination Committee referred to in sub-section (1) shall consist of the following persons, namely:-

(i) One person nominated by the Chancellor;

(ii) Two nominees of the Board of Governors, one of whom shall be nominated as the Convener of the Committee by the Board of Governors;

(3) The Nomination Committee shall, on the basis of merit, recommend three persons suitable to hold the office of the Vice-Chancellor and forward the same to the Chancellor along with a concise statement showing the academic qualifications and other distinctions of each person.

(4) The Vice-Chancellor shall be the Principal Executive and Academic Officer of the University and shall exercise general supervision and control over the affairs of the University and give effect to the decisions of the authorities of the University.

(5) Where any matter, other than the appointment of a Teacher is of urgent nature requiring immediate action and the same could not be immediately dealt with by any officer or the authority or other body of the University empowered by or under this Ordinance to deal with it, the Vice- Chancellor may take such action as he may deem fit with the prior written approval of the Chancellor.

(6) The Vice-Chancellor shall exercise such other powers and perform such other duties as may be laid down by the Statutes or the Rules.

(7) The services of the Vice-Chancellor can be terminated by the Chancellor with the approval of the Board of Governors and Chancellor after following the principles of natural justice and after providing an opportunity to present his / her case including for termination on disciplinary grounds.

(8) The Vice-Chancellor shall preside at the convocation of the University in the absence of the Visitor and Chancellor.
